- The distance between Longreach Post Office, Australia and Luanda, Angola is approximately 13,598 km or 8,450 mi.
- To reach Longreach Post Office in this distance one would set out from Luanda bearing 125.1°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Longreach Post Office bearing 61.8° or ENE .
- Both have a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Both are in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The annual average temperature is 1.5 °C (2.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.6 °C (15.5°F) more in Longreach Post Office.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 66.7 mm (2.6 in) more which is equivalent to 66.7 l/m² (1.64 US gal/ft²) or 667,000 l/ha (71,307 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.6° lower in Longreach Post Office than in Luanda.
